Lake Smith Terrace, located between Lake Smith and the Norfolk city line, is a residential and lakeside Virginia Beach neighborhood with a wooded shoreline and mid-century streetscapes.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the Lake Smith/Lake Lawson Natural Area trailheads, where boardwalk paths, birdlife, and kayaks set the daily rhythm. Brick ranches and split-levels sit on curving roads with mature trees and long driveways, giving the blocks a quiet, established feel. The lake edge reads like a small retreat, with water views and pockets of marshy habitat. The purpose of the Residential Districts is to provide areas for residential housing types at a variety of densities, provide for harmonious neighborhoods located so as to create compatibility and to provide for certain other necessary and related uses within residential communities but limited as to maintain neighborhood compatibility. The R-40, R-30 and R-20 Residential Districts provide for larger minimum lot sizes for use in areas where lower residential densities are necessary to address environmental and public facilities constraints as recommended by the comprehensive plan. The R-15, R-10 and R-7.5 Residential Districts provide for medium density single-family residential development in areas where these densities are recommended by the comprehensive plan. The R-5D Residential Duplex District is created in recognition of the existence of developed areas where single-family and semidetached dwellings exist on lots averaging five thousand square feet in area and where duplexes exist on lots of ten thousand square feet in area. It is not the intention to create additional R-5D Districts or to enlarge the limits of existing R-5D Districts. The R-5R Residential Resort District is created in recognition of the existence of developed areas where single-family and duplex dwellings exist on lots of less than seven thousand five hundred square feet of area and where the character of the neighborhood includes both permanent yearround residents as well as seasonal residents. It is not the intention to create additional R-5R Districts or to enlarge the limits of existing R-5R Districts. The R-5S Residential Single-Family District is created in recognition of the existence of developed areas where single-family dwellings exist on lots with fifty- and sixty-foot frontages. It is not the intention to create additional R-5S Districts or to enlarge the limits of existing R-5S Districts.
